Re-write the sentences (making them grammatically correct) adding an indirect object pronoun before the conjugated verb or attac

hing them to the infinitive to represent the underlined indirect object
1. Yo doy el libro a Ana.

2. Nosotros vamos a recomendar el restaurante a nuestra familia.

3. Yo digo las noticias a ella.
Spanish
1 answer:
timofeeve [1]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Yo le doy el libro a Ana.

Nosotros vamos a recomendar este restaurante a nuestra familia.

Yo le digo las noticias a ella.
